What Are Social Casinos?
A social casino is an online platform that allows users to play casino games, such as slots, poker, and card games, in a social context. Unlike traditional casinos, social casinos do not involve real money gambling. Instead, players utilize virtual currency or “coins” to place bets, allowing them to experience the thrill of gaming without the financial risks associated with real money gambling.
Key Features of Social Casinos
Social casinos are characterized by several key features:
- Free to Play: Most social casinos allow users to sign up and play for free, making gaming accessible to a larger audience.
- Virtual Currency: Players use virtual coins to play games. These coins can often be purchased with real money but are not redeemable for cash.
- Social Interactions: Users can connect with friends, share achievements, and compete against each other, fostering a sense of community.
- Freemium Model: While playing is free, many social casinos offer optional in-game purchases to enhance the gaming experience.
How Social Casinos Operate
Social casinos utilize a combination of game mechanics, monetization strategies, and user engagement techniques to create an immersive gaming experience.

Game Mechanics
At their core, social casinos employ game mechanics similar to those found in traditional casinos. These include:
- Chance and Randomness: Social casino games rely on random number generators (RNG) to ensure fair play and unpredictable outcomes, just like in traditional slots and table games.
- Levels and Progression: Many social casinos incorporate levels or achievements that allow players to progress and feel a sense of accomplishment as they play.
- Rewards and Bonuses: Social casinos often give players daily bonuses, free spins, or rewards for completing certain tasks, keeping players engaged and incentivized to return.
Monetization Strategies
While social casinos do not offer real money gambling, they employ various monetization strategies:
- In-Game Purchases: Players have the option to purchase virtual currency, additional lives, or special features, enhancing their gaming experience.
- Advertising: Some social casinos feature advertisements that allow them to generate revenue through partnerships with other companies.
- Sponsorships and Promotions: Social casinos often collaborate with brands for promotions, further increasing engagement and potential revenue streams.

Differences Between Social Casinos and Traditional Gambling
It’s important to understand the distinctions between social casinos and traditional gambling platforms:
- No Real Money Stakes: Players in social casinos do not wager real money, whereas traditional casinos require an initial investment to play.
- Player Accountability: Social casinos promote responsible gaming by allowing players to enjoy casino games without the risk of heavy financial losses.
- Focus on Entertainment: Social casinos emphasize entertainment and social interaction rather than gambling for profit.
